atrislabs/atris holds a health index of 69 out of 100, placing it in the Good band. It scores highest on Vitality (94/100) and lowest on Community & Adoption (36/100). It was last updated today. A single contributor accounts for most of its recent work.

Metrics are grouped into weighted categories on one standardized 1–100 scale. Overall starts as their weighted mean, calibrated against the distribution of the public record so bands carry percentile meaning; when public evidence triggers the High-Risk Jurisdiction Policy, the rating is adjusted and receives an At Risk ceiling of 34.

69
Exceptional93-100The record's top tier (≈ top 5%); essentially all checked criteria met
Excellent80-92Strong across the board; minor gaps
Good65-79Healthy; gaps are limited and manageable
Moderate50-64Acceptable with notable gaps; review recommended
Weak35-49Material weaknesses across several areas
At Risk20-34Significant weaknesses; adoption warrants caution
Critical1-19Severe problems (abandoned, single-maintainer, no hygiene)
